Rupee extends losing streak to fourth session, down against dollar
The local currency gained as dollar was seen weakening against a basket of major currencies ahead of the US Federal Reserve's policy review starting today.

The domestic currency opened firm at 64.05 against the greenback, recording up 9 paise. However, the gains could not last long.
The domestic currency lost momentum as the session proceeded and hit its day's low of 64.24, before recovering some lost ground.
Forex dealers said weak domestic equity market and dollar's strength against other currencies overseas hurt the exchange rate.
All eyes were on the two-day US Federal Reserve's policy review starting today. The review will conclude tomorrow.
